    Re: Who remember these old girls?

    Quote Originally Posted by Nobbie View Post
    It seems our Mr A was.

    My new front bumper, what do ya all tink?

    I can see why cool running stats and 2 rads does make some sense. I think he later found that the first rad that was on there was full of ****e.

    Its a second radiator that has been plumbed in series with the first.
    If it was full of ****e then putting another radiator in series with it probably wouldnt help much, putting one in parrelel might of but thats not how it was plumbed in anyway.

    I see no reason at all to run 2 rads on an XE nova, if your one rad isnt keeping temps under 90 degrees because its knackered then remove it and fit one that does.



    Im sure JohnnyA knows better these days, and at least while he was young and foolish he was prepared to dare to be different and give things a go, even if in this instance it was a pretty stupid idea lmao
